摘要:

采用电感耦合等离子发射光谱法(ICP-AES)对鲜鸭蛋和铅法皮蛋蛋壳、蛋白、蛋黄中的Pb、Cu、Mg、Zn、Ca、Fe 等20 种无机元素进行分析测定。该方法的加标回收率为84.4%~112.2%,相对标准偏差小于7%,20 种元素的方法检测限在0.4~10g/L 之间。结果表明:铅法皮蛋可食部分中富含多种人体所必需的无机元素,且其蛋黄中的大部分有机元素含量皆高于蛋白。鲜鸭蛋经加工成皮蛋后,Cu、Fe、Al、Pb、Mn 等元素在各部位含量明显升高,其中有害元素Pb 的含量大大提高,且由外到内其Pb 的含量增幅呈逐渐减少的趋势。实验同时说明:ICP-AES 法是一种快速、准确、灵敏测定皮蛋中无机元素的有效方法。

Abstract:

In the present study, the contents of twenty inorganic elements such as Pb, Cu, Mg, Zn, Ca and Fe in fresh duck eggs and lead-prepared preserved eggs by ICP-AES. The recovery rates of spiked standard samples were in the range of 84.4%-112.2% with the relative standard deviation less than 7%. The detection limits of this method for twenty elements were in the range of 0.4-10 g/L. Results showed that lead-prepared preserved eggs were rich in essential inorganic elements, and the contents of most of organic elements in yolk were higher than those in egg white. Compared with fresh duck eggs, the contents of Cu, Fe, Al, Pb and Mn were significantly increased in preserved eggs. The content of Pb was greatly improved, and the increased trend of Pb content was exhibited a gradual attenuation trend from outside to inside. Meanwhile, experimental results indicated that ICP-AES technique could be used to determine inorganic elements in lead-prepared preserved eggs, which is characteristics of easy operation, accuracy and high sensitivity.
